PTEN抑癌基因对高转移性粘液表皮样癌细胞药物敏感性的影响  

Effects of exogenous tumor suppressor gene PTEN on chemosensitivity of human highly metastatic mucoepidermoid carcinoma cell line in vitro

摘  要:目的 评价外源性PTEN抑癌基因对人高转移性粘液表皮样癌细胞系M 3SP2药物敏感性的影响。方法 用脂质体介导法将PTEN抑癌基因导入M 3SP2细胞系 ,以空载体转染细胞为对照 ,然后应用MTT比色法测定两种癌细胞对 10种常用抗癌药物敏感性。结果 与对照细胞比较 ,PTEN基因转染细胞对 6种抗癌药物甲氨喋呤、重组人干扰素 -γ、丝裂霉素、多西环素、平阳霉素和氟脲嘧啶的相对抗肿瘤活性呈不同程度地增强 ,药物增敏比增加了 1.5~ 5 2 .1倍。结论 外源性野生型PTEN抑癌基因能增强粘液表皮样癌细胞对常用抗癌药物的敏感性。Objective To evaluate exogenous tumor suppressor gene PTEN on in vitro chemosensitivity of human highly metastatic mucoepidermoid carcinoma cell line M3SP2.Methods Retrovirus expression vector containing wild-type PTEN gene or control vector were introduced into the M3SP2 cells by using cationic liposome, and PTEN transfected cells were named as M3SP2-PTEN, the control vector transfected cells as M3SP2-pBp.The chemosensitivity of the above two cancer cell lines to 10 kinds of anticancer drugs was determined by MTT assay.Results Comparing with the control cells, the PTEN transfected cells revealed more sensitivity to anticancer drugs, such as methotrexate, interferon-γ, mitomycin C, doxycycline, and pinyangmycin, and the sensitizing enhancement ratio increased by 1.5~52.1.Conclusion Introduction of PTEN gene into highly metastatic mucoepidermoid carcinoma cell line can enhance the cells sensitivity to chemotherapeutic agents.
